EHF bans Kosovo confrontations

Kosovo's U-20 representative in handball (children) on March 23rd must face Serbia's U-20 representative. This match according to schedule will be played in Serbia. It is the Executive Committee of the European Handball Federation that has decided to avoid Kosovo confrontations at the level of representatives. The Kosovo Handball Federation has been announced through a letter from the EHF to the decision, Koha Ditore writes today.
At the latest meeting of the EHF Executive Committee held in Zagreb, a decision has been made that Kosovo cannot be in a group with Serbia from now on. The same decision applies to Macedonia with Greece”, Izet Djindovci, secretary general of the Kosovo Handball Federation, said on Friday.
Due to reports between the two states, the planned meeting on March 23rd has created numerous trouble for the EHF. Although less than a month until the match remains, there is no clear decision on which city the meeting will be played, whether state symbols are allowed or under what conditions this match will be played.
